I also made the “One Pot Mexican Rice Casserole” to go with it. I will definitely be making this one again. Here is a look at a serving so you can see all the yumminess under the toppings:
1 pound hamburger
1 packet taco seasoning (I also added 1 can pinto beans, drained and rinsed)
2 cups nacho cheese Doritos, crushed
8 oz cream cheese, softened
1/2 cup salsa
2 cups shredded cheddar cheese, divided
2 cups shredded lettuce
2 medium tomatoes, diced
1 Grease 9 x 13″ pan and spread crushed Doritos on bottom of pan.
2 Cook hamburger and taco seasoning until done. (Then I added the can of pinto beans.)
3 Spoon hamburger over the Doritos.
4 Beat cream cheese then slowly add salsa until well combined.
5 Spread cream cheese mixture over hamburger.
6 Top cream cheese with 1 1/2 cups shredded cheese.
7 Top cheese with lettuce and then tomatoes and then remaining 1/2 cup of cheese.
8 Bake at 350 for 10 – 15 minutes or until cheese on top is melted.
